1. Software Developer
Software development remains one of the most popular career choices after B.Tech CSE. Software developers design, build, test, and maintain applications used by millions of users worldwide.
From web applications and mobile apps to enterprise systems and cloud-based solutions, software developers are essential to modern businesses.

2.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ning Engineer
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) have emerged as some of the fastest-growing technology domains globally.
AI engineers create intelligent systems capable of learning from data, recognizing patterns, automating processes, and making predictions. Applications of AI can be found in healthcare, finance, e-commerce, education, transportation, and smart technologies.

3. Data Scientist
Data is often considered the most valuable asset for modern organizations. Data Scientists help companies extract meaningful insights from large datasets to improve decision-making and business outcomes.
This career combines programming, mathematics, statistics, machine learning, and business understanding.

With industries increasingly relying on data-driven strategies, demand for data science professionals continues to rise.
4. Cyber Security Specialist
As organizations become more digitally connected, cyber threats continue to increase. Cyber Security Specialists protect networks, applications, databases, and digital infrastructure from security risks and cyberattacks.
Career opportunities in cybersecurity include:
- Security Analyst
- Ethical Hacker
- Information Security Consultant
- Network Security Engineer
- Digital Forensics Expert
Cybersecurity remains one of the most stable and high-demand career options for CSE graduates.
5. Cloud Computing Engineer
Organizations are rapidly shifting from traditional infrastructure to cloud-based systems. Cloud Engineers design, deploy, and manage scalable cloud solutions that support modern business operations.
Cloud computing professionals work on infrastructure management, cloud architecture, application deployment, and system optimization.

6. Full Stack Developer
Full Stack Developers possess expertise in both frontend and backend development. They can build complete applications from user interface design to database management and server-side functionality.
Because of their versatility, Full Stack Developers are highly valued by startups, technology companies, and digital businesses.
7. Blockchain Developer
Blockchain technology is expanding beyond cryptocurrencies into areas such as digital identity, healthcare, supply chain management, and secure transactions.
Blockchain Developers create decentralized applications and secure systems that improve transparency and trust across digital ecosystems.
As blockchain adoption grows, this field presents exciting opportunities for future-ready engineers.
8. Internet of Things (IoT) Engineer
The Internet of Things connects devices, sensors, and systems through the internet, enabling smart environments and real-time communication.
IoT Engineers work on:
- Smart Devices
- Industrial Automation
- Connected Vehicles
- Smart Homes
- Healthcare Monitoring Systems
The growing adoption of connected technologies makes IoT a promising career path for engineering graduates.
9. Research and Higher Education
Students interested in innovation and academic growth may pursue higher education such as M.Tech, MBA, or specialized postgraduate programs.
Research careers allow graduates to contribute to technological advancements in Artificial Intelligence, Robotics, Cyber Security, Cloud Computing, and other emerging fields.

10. Technology Entrepreneur
Many Computer Science graduates choose entrepreneurship as a career path. With strong technical knowledge and innovative ideas, graduates can launch startups focused on software products, AI solutions, educational technology, cybersecurity services, or digital platforms.
The startup ecosystem continues to create opportunities for young engineers to solve real-world problems through technology-driven innovation.
